Lets compare vitamin content per 500 calories of Dill Weed vs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t:
500 calories of Dill Weed have 147.7 times more Vitamin C than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t.
500 calories of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C
Comparing minerals per 500 calories for Dill Weed vs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t:
500 calories of Dill Weed have 41 times more Calcium, 38.9 times more Iron, 4.8 times more Potassium and 3.7 times more Water than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t.
While 500 kcal of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t contain 1.7 times more Sodium than Fresh Dill Weed.
500 calories of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 500 calories:
500 calories of Dill Weed have 1.8 times more Fat, 2.4 times more Fiber and 4.6 times more Protein than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t.
While 500 kcal of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t contain 1.3 times more Carbohydrate than Fresh Dill Weed.
